Echocardiographic findings in a patient with Candida endocarditis of the aortic valve.

S Arvan, N Cagin, B Levitt, J J Kleid.   

Abstract

The echocardiographic appearance of fungal endocarditis of the aortic valve is described in a patient who subsequently died from this disease. In addition, the progressive growth of the vegetation on serial echocardiograms was recorded, and premature closure of the mitral valve was absent, notwithstanding perforation of two aortic cusps.
